Chapter 101 The Messenger from Xianyang is Very Busy!



The next day, early morning.

Before dawn, the sound of horses' hooves broke the silence of Xianyang.

People dressed and came out to watch, wondering what major event had occurred.

Speaking of which, ever since the King assumed personal rule, the messengers in Xianyang have been extremely busy.

At this moment, in a corner of Xianyang City.

"Quickly, send more people to ensure the message reaches all counties as quickly as possible."

"Has the messenger from Yelang set off yet?"

"......."

People came and went in the mansion, each with a solemn expression and hurried steps.

In the middle of the courtyard, the wicked husband sat imposingly, with a large wooden table in front of him, which appeared to be newly made.

In this era, there were only low tables and chairs, and people preferred to sit upright, which was neither convenient nor comfortable for actually doing business. Therefore, he had Xiang Lihe make this table and chair overnight.

"General!"

"The soldiers sent to the various prefectures have already set off!"

Feng Jie strode over, and despite being quite old, he exuded a spirited and energetic aura.

"Have you notified Xianyang yet?" The wicked man didn't even lift his eyelids, but kept stroking the hilt of the long sword at his waist.

Feng Jie shook his head and said in a low voice, "Xianyang is a special case. I would appreciate it if the general could personally go to the city to oversee the situation!"

As the central city of Qin, Xianyang had a population of up to one million, and the surrounding farmland was in the hands of high-ranking officials and nobles. The influence was extremely wide, and his prestige was insufficient to suppress it.

If this causes a mutiny, it could lead to a major disaster!

The wicked man didn't say anything, got up and strode out of the house, with Feng Jie quickly calling for people to follow.

In the middle of Xianyang City.

The wicked man sat on the high place, still sitting in that same chair.

Before long, the people in the city who had received the news flocked to the streets and moved toward the center of the city.

Even the people living outside the city flocked to the city, eager to hear the new policies being promulgated.

The wicked man looked up at the vast crowd in the distance and ordered, "Wait, wait until all the people have arrived before making the announcement."

Meanwhile, powerful local gentry who had received advance notice also came in person.

"May I ask, Your Excellency, what new policy has the King issued?" asked a burly man at the front.

He was one of the most powerful families in Xianyang, holding considerable land and having a marriage relationship with a high-ranking official in the imperial court.

He had known about the land tax reform policy for a long time, and the high-ranking official had repeatedly warned him not to show his face or commit any illegal acts.

However, this was all the wealth he had painstakingly accumulated throughout his life, and he was unwilling to give it away like that.

Right now, his question is intended to provoke resistance from the wealthy families.

Feng Jie glanced at the fat man and whispered in his ear, "A wealthy family in Xianyang, they have some connection with the Grand Master of Cerebro."

The wicked man nodded, continuing to close his eyelids and rub the hilt of the sword at his waist.

When the fat man saw that his wicked husband was ignoring him, he was filled with rage. Even if his wicked husband had three heads and six arms, he didn't believe he would dare to kill all of them, these wealthy people.

Based on this, the fat man's subsequent irrational behavior almost made officials like Feng Jie and Li Si burst out laughing.

“We are all people of Qin. If the country is in trouble, we will certainly help generously. Why should we share the property we have worked so hard to acquire?”

These words immediately drew a chorus of jeers from many wealthy families.

Some people even took advantage of the chaos to shout, "Even the king can't be unreasonable. If we unite to resist, even the king will have to think twice."

"Who do you think you are, to presume to make decisions for us and divide our inheritance?!"

Li Si and the others smiled knowingly. The last person to speak to a wicked husband like that was probably already buried with grass growing over ten meters tall.

The wicked man's lips curled into a cold smile. See? This is how money can move people's hearts; to preserve their wealth and status, they can even forget fear.

Keep in mind, this was during the Warring States period!

Commerce was underdeveloped, far less so than in dynasties like the Tang and Song. Yet these merchants dared to act this way. No wonder that for thousands of years, those in power have been trying their best to suppress merchants in all aspects.

Just like Emperor Zhu Yuanzhang of the Ming Dynasty, who decreed that merchants throughout the land should not wear brocade and fine clothes, so as to avoid creating bad trends.

The policy of suppressing commerce and prioritizing agriculture may not simply be due to the fear that no one would grow food.

"presumptuous!"

Seeing that these people were becoming increasingly audacious and showing such contempt for their general, Zhang Erhe roared with murderous intent.

With a 'whoosh', his battle sword was drawn, pointed at these wealthy men, and he said coldly, "Sitting before you now is the Commandant of the Guards, General Qianniu, one of the Nine Ministers of Qin, Lord Evil!"

"He personally quelled Lü Buwei's rebellion, eliminated Lao Ai's plot to rebel, and assisted the King in assuming personal rule."

"Those who dare to lead three thousand soldiers to fight in the north and south!"

"How dare you be so rude! Are you truly not afraid of death?"

Upon hearing this, the noise immediately vanished.

How could they not know who the wicked husband is?

Who in the entire city of Xianyang didn't recognize that handsome young face?

The reason they did this was to give him a warning, so that the matter of merging the poll tax into the land tax could be implemented later.

However, they underestimated the ruthlessness of the wicked husband and Ying Zheng's determination, and they did not expect that the entire court had already compromised on this matter.

"kill!"

"Those who insult their superiors shall be executed."

"To defy the king's orders is punishable by death."

"Those who obstruct the Qin state's path to eternal prosperity shall be executed!"

“All of these crimes are serious, and one should implicate one’s relatives, friends, clansmen and in-laws.”

Li Si took over the conversation, his face icy cold, and he uttered a series of chilling, icy judgments that sent shivers down one's spine.

As soon as he finished speaking, hundreds of Qin soldiers rushed out from both sides of the street.

"puff!!"

Before the obese man could react, his fat head had already rolled to the ground.

Amidst the flashing blades, the Qin soldiers showed no mercy, slaughtering all those who had joined in the commotion.

Before they arrived, they received military orders not to kill only the ringleaders, but to kill the innocent rather than let the guilty go free!

They thought the bloody scene would frighten the people, but to their surprise, many people burst into laughter, their laughter filled with unrestrained joy.

"Class conflicts can never be resolved; as long as the interests of the majority are protected, that's fine."

The wicked man sighed inwardly. In truth, what these wealthy people said wasn't wrong. From their perspective, their vast fortunes didn't come from thin air; they were the result of a lifetime, or even generations, of hard work and sweat.

In this kind of situation, it's not a matter of who's right and who's wrong; it's simply a matter of perspective.

As a monarch, Ying Zheng desired a prosperous and powerful nation, and to achieve the title of an emperor.

For the wicked man, his purpose in traveling through time was to ensure that everyone had food to eat, to exterminate all foreign tribes, and to eradicate their entire lineage, so as to guarantee the peace and tranquility of China for generations to come.

For the poor and the rich, they are actually the same; all they are doing is trying to survive and to survive better.

However, the majority of them were poor, so they had to be sacrificed.

If the situation were reversed, with the wealthy holding the majority, it would be uncertain who would ultimately be the victim.

The words may be harsh, but the reasoning is sound.

Ultimately, this is the food chain. Whoever stands at the top sets the rules and regulations, and those below must make way for their dreams and plans.

Anyone who gets in the way dies!
